Penn Foster Career School Launches Online Certified Personal Trainer Program
Penn Foster Career School has launched a new online program to become a certified personal trainer. The new course will prepare students for NCSF certification.
SCRANTON, PA, April 30, 2009 /24-7PressRelease/ -- Penn Foster Career School, one of the oldest and largest online learning institutions in the world, has launched a new Certified Personal Trainer Program.
With Penn Foster's Certified Personal Trainer Program, students will receive thorough training in the techniques and skills of a Personal Trainer plus a National Council on Strength and Fitness (NCSF) Certification Package that contains materials that will prepare them for NCSF Certification. As part of this package, students will also receive a voucher for the actual NCSF Certification Exam.
The U.S. Department of Labor is projecting a 27% increase in personal training jobs over the next decade. However, in order to take advantage of this employment growth most fitness workers need to be certified. Recognizing the importance of certification in this field is what lead Penn Foster to develop their new Certified Personal Trainer Program.
"We realized that, in order for our students to take advantage of the explosive growth in this field, they would need to be certified. Including a certification component in our fitness program will increase the likelihood that graduates of this program will go on to be successful in this field," stated Stuart Udell, CEO of Penn Foster.
